Key Features to Look for in Grocery POS Software When selecting a grocery POS, prioritize features that streamline checkout and maintain accurate inventory records. Inventory Management Inventory management is one of the most important features of grocery POS software. It allows you to manage all products instantly and in one place. For example, real time tracking shows exactly which items are in stock and where they are located, making it easy to find any product quickly. Another valuable feature is automatic stock alerts. The system records all item data, so if a product is running low, it will notify you before it goes out of stock. Similarly, if an item’s expiration date is approaching, the POS system will flag it so you can take action on time. Barcode Scanning The barcode system is one of the most important features of a POS system because it makes checkout fast. With it, items can be scanned and processed in very little time. There are mainly two types of barcodes used in the market: 1D (linear) and 2D (matrix). To read these barcodes, a scanner is required, and for 2D codes specifically, a QR code scanner is used. A POS system makes it possible to handle all these registers efficiently under one platform. Offline Mode Offline service is another crucial feature of a POS system. When there is no internet connection or a power outage, the system should still be able to run smoothly. Offline mode works as a backup function, allowing sales and operations to continue without interruption. That’s why, when choosing a POS system, it’s important to make sure this feature is included. FAQs How Do I Set Up a POS System? First, you need to choose a POS system based on your business type. Then, purchase the right hardware such as a POS terminal (tablet or PC), receipt printer, cash drawer, barcode scanner, and card reader. After that, install the POS software and complete the sign-up process. Once signed up, configure your store settings by adding details like store name, working hours, and address. Next, load your inventory into the system by entering product names, prices, or codes. When everything is set up, connect and test the hardware to ensure it works properly. Run a test transaction to confirm everything is functioning smoothly. If all looks good, you’re ready to officially launch your POS system. How Much Does a Typical Convenience Store POS System Cost? There are two main options when purchasing a POS system: On-Premise POS System and Cloud-Based POS System. On-Premise POS System: An on-premise POS system can cost anywhere between $2,500 and $50,000. Cloud-Based POS System: A cloud-based POS system typically costs between $49 and $99 per month, with a one-time setup fee ranging from $1,500 to $2,500.

Handle Legal & Licensing Requirements The rules for getting a license are varied in each country. You will need to look into what your country requires. If you get stuck after that, contact your country's Small Business Association. You will probably require a license to sell food in a business. If you plan to sell alcohol, you need a license. If you offer cooked food, you need licenses from the Department of Health. General liability insurance protects you from incidents that happen in or outside of your store and from problems with your products. If any of your employees become hurt or sick because they work in your store. You will also need workers compensation insurance to help pay for medical care and other costs. The National Grocers Association is a group that helps small grocery stores. Their website has useful information, and they can help you get started. Yes, supermarkets earn a lot of money, but not by charging high prices rather by selling a large volume of products. Usually, supermarkets make a profit of around 1% to 5%. Most of their profit comes from advertisements by large companies. Large companies advertise their products in big supermarkets so that those products sell. This generates income for the supermarkets. In addition, companies offer significant discounts on many products, from which supermarkets also make a profit. As a result, many customers come to their stores, and their sales increase. What Is the Highest-Paid Position in a Supermarket? In supermarkets, the top earning roles are usually the store manager and department managers. The store manager is in charge of overall store operations and ensuring profitability. Department managers, on the other hand, supervise individual sections such as grocery, produce, or meat, handling both inventory and team management.

NetSuite NetSuite is one of the leading inventory management software that is helping retail business to grow for a long time. Retailers often struggle with stock visibility, especially those scaling across multiple channels and locations. Poor inventory control also led to inefficiency, and wasted capital tied up in. NetSuite Inventory Management solves these problems with a centralized, real-time system. This system brings clarity, automation, and precision to inventory workflows. While traditional systems rely on manual decisions, NetSuite’s demand-based replenishment calculates reorder points. It uses historical sales, seasonal demand, and lead times to automate purchase orders. Its Smart Count feature is so useful that you don’t need to shut down operations for cycle counts. If there’s any stock changes the system automatically updates it and alerts staff. Essential Features of NetSuite Multi-location visibility in real-time. Demand-based reorder tools. Real-time cycle counting named Smart Count. Lot and serial number tracking. Supports FIFO, LIFO, and average inventory costing. Inventory reporting and forecasting. 4. Odoo Oddo Inventory is a fully integrated warehouse management system embedded within the Odoo ERP ecosystem. It is designed for real-time visibility across multiple warehouses and locations. Odoo Inventory offers smart replenishment rules such as minimum-maximum thresholds, and make-to-order workflows. Besides, its master production scheduling reduces manual tasks with automatic replenishment, and advanced routing. From warehouse layout to picking, Odoo includes modern storage and routing logic like push/pull strategies. There’s also options like ABC analysis, cross-docking, and optimized put-away rules. Advanced picking methods like single, batch, cluster, or wave picking help to increase fulfillment efficiency. Not to mention that, its super fast barcode scanning keeps your inventory accurate through online and offline. Essential Features of Odoo Instant multi-warehouse inventory tracking. Smart replenishment with automated rules and triggers. Advanced routing and storage logic. Flexible picking methods for faster fulfillment. Barcode scanning and GS1 label compatibility. Lot and serial number tracking. Configurable removal strategies (FIFO, FEFO, LIFO, LEFO). Perpetual inventory valuation with accounting integration. 8. In this guide, we break down the Top 10 Best POS Software for Retail Stores in Bangladesh. What Is POS Software? A POS software is also known as Point-of-Sale software. It’s a digital solution for businesses that manage sales transactions, track inventory, and process payments. A POS system is the central hub of a business to manage its day-to-day operations. POS solution is a great successor to the manual billing system. It not only changes the process but also saves time, decreases errors, and increases accuracy across business. With POS software, you can easily manage your billing, inventory, tax calculation, customer loyalty program, etc. Types of POS Software Normally there are three types of POS software which are used in retail business: Cloud-Based POS: Cloud-based POS are run through online, and accessible from any device. It’s an ideal solution for remote management of the business. Offline POS: Offline POS works fine without the internet. Most of them sync data with cloud servers while reconnected with the internet. However, there are few offline solutions which store data in the local storage and work completely offline. These are useful during load-shedding or poor internet connectivity. Hybrid POS: Hybrid POS are combined with both offline and cloud pos functionality. Nowadays, most of the POS systems are built on this concept.
